The expert in this case is and always has been the science of embryology. The Church has always followed science on this issue. In the medieval era, the Church followed Aristotelian science, thought to be true at the time. Men came into being about 30 days after conception, women some time later! This is what Thomas Aquinas states following the science of the time! Real scientific study of these issues only started about 150 years ago when we had the means and technology to study them. The invention of the microscope is one such invention. Embryology today leaves no doubt at all that the human being has its beginning at fertilisation of the ovum by the sperm to produce a zygote or embryo. This one cell, which unlike any other cell in the body, has the intrinsic active potential to develop into an adult human being. If left alone, even initially outside the uterus, it divides and grows into an adult. All scientific evidence both genetic and epigenetic leaves no doubt on this issue. That one early cell has all the requisites to be considered the first cell of the human being which ends up building to trillions of cells. Starts as one cell and ends up as a bunch of cells! This is the first cell of the species Homo sapiens.

It is because of what science tells us, that the Church expects all human beings to respect the developing embryo from fertilisation onwards. Reason tells us to give respect, dignity and legal rights to other members of the human race and therefore the early human life is not only a human being but should be regarded as a human person like all other human beings who are accorded Natural Rights to life and development in line with natural law. It is because of what science tells us today that the Church has changed its position from the Aristotelian one to the present!
